Strictly Come Dancing star Ellie Taylor has given birth after going into labour early. The comedian and TV star, 39, who was partnered up with professional dancer Johannes Radebe during the BBC One dance competition last year, has welcomed a baby boy.
As a result, Ellie, who is already mum to five year old daughter Valentina, was unfortunately forced to pull out of her scheduled gig at the Royal Variety Performance in London.
The Ted Lasso actress shared a teaser snap as she recovered in hospital, along with a glimpse of her adorable little tot. Wearing surgical white socks and cuddled up in bed, Ellie wrapped her arms around her little one, as he lay snoozing under a green blanket.
The newborn baby boy was also wearing a knitted bright red beanie hat, and Ellie also posted a look at her fabulous gold sparkly dress that she'd planned to wear for the variety show. "This is the fabulous outfit I was meant to be wearing tonight while doing stand-up at the @royalvarietyperformance in front of 4,000 people, including @princeandprincessofwales," Ellie captioned her post, which also included a fabulous mirror selfie of her during prep for the event.
"Swipe to see the actual outfit I’ll be wearing tonight due to the surprise early arrival of my own little HRH… "Gutted to miss out but also very very happy to be wearing giant mesh knickers and saying “But his skin is just so SOFT!” ten times an hour," the star continued."Mother and baby doing well because mummy has access to morphine and baby has access to boobies," Ellie went on, in her trademark signature wit. Katya Jones has shared her 'heartbreak' after an unexpected exit from Strictly Come Dancing after her celebrity partner Nigel Harman injured himself during rehearsals.The former EastEnders star, 50, had to leave the BBC show at the quarter-final stage on Saturday due to a rib injury, something both he and Katya were heartbroken by. Nigel, 50, explained to shocked viewers during the broadcast that he had an accident while jumping from a rostrum, which led to a trip to A&E. With no other option, Nigel and Katya had to withdraw from the series.

Strictly Come Dancing star Angela Scanlon broke down as she discussed her devastating exit from the BBC One show over the weekend.The 39 year old faced Bad Education star Layton Williams, 29, in the dance-off after they both landed in the bottom following the judges scores and a public vote. Judges Craig Revel Horwood, Motsi Mabuse and Anton Du Beke chose to save Layton and professional Nikita Kuzmin after they re-performed an American Smooth routine to It’s Oh So Quiet by Bjork.

But despite scoring high from the beginning of the series, Nigel was left downhearted during last Saturday's (November 18) Blackpool special.The actor, 50, and his professional dance partner Katya Jones did a quickstep to Duke Ellington’s song It Don’t Mean A Thing, which left them second from the bottom of the leaderboard.They received a total score of 31 points out of 40.This week Nigel and Katya will be doing the rumba to It's All Coming Back To Me Now by Celine Dion as they hope to glide into week 11 of the competition.
